I have some applications where I need to
load Tiger Data along with the StreetInfo data that we purchased from our
MapInfo dealer. When I compare the two… for example
I-25 in Denver in both databases, there is a variance of up to 200 feet (I-25/Tiger
Data from I-25 StreetInfo Data). Is there a projection issue that I’m
missing (both are in Long/Lat) Is there just that much inaccuracy in one
or the other? What am I doing wrong? Can I correct it
(short of redrawing the Tiger Data element that I need…..) Thanks!
